The logical status of the use and the user is ambiguous in design utterances that deals with a reality that does not yet exist. This article proposes a logical construct to understand the specificity of these utterances implied by the design context. It proceeds to a thought experiment comparing statements from sociology and design to understand what distinguishes them. The status of the use and of the user appears to oscillate between genuine reference and undecidability. The use would thus be simulated by speech acts mimicking normal assertions in the manner of fictional speech. But the pragmatics of design also suggests some distinctions from fiction, notably in its aim of reality. Finally, we will outline the links that this analysis has with current practices such as participative design, scale 1, making scenarios, the use of big data or neuroarchitecture.
